The Pride of the Yankees

Trivia: In the movie, Lou Gehrig concludes his farewell speech with the famous line "I consider myself the luckiest man on the face of the earth". However, in real life, he continued after this point. The last lines of his speech were "And I might have been given a bad break, but I've got an awful lot to live for. Thank you."

Trivia: At the end of the film Lou is seen walking off the field into the dugout. In truth after the speech, Lou had to be helped into the dugout and left the ballpark in a wheelchair.
